## Configuration

Scrubnik strips EXIF data (GPS, device serials, the works) from every image before it hits the Pellwood CDN. For the security review: all behavior is driven by .env — scrub mode, allowed tags, and quarantine path are plain settings, documented in env.sample. The only sensitive entry is the quarantine bucket credential, which should be added on the line below.

sealed setting: VAULT_KEY20=c8ea1e419912889df6b4

Admin escalations must
# be logged in the access journal table, including who approved the change
# and when it expires. If a user reports missing pages, check role caching
# first, then inspect the journal directly. The journal lives in the
# permissions database, reachable with the connection string that follows.

warehouse DSN: mssql://rusdor_svc:0FSWCn9@db-951a.paliqforge.local:5432/ulawyn

### Runbook: BounceBroom — Account Recovery

If the BounceBroom email bounce processor loses access to its service account, do not create a new one. First, pause the intake queue so bounces buffer safely. Then open the recovery console and select the BounceBroom principal. Verification requires approval from the on-call lead. Once approved, the console prompts for the stored recovery credentials; enter the passphrase that appears directly below this paragraph.

recovery phrase for fahof-kahap: holion-gormir-jorix-istix-briwyn-sorael

## Changelog — Reportly Exports v4.2

Renamed setting: `EXPORT_TZ_MODE` is now `REPORT_EXPORT_TIMEZONE_POLICY`. The old name is still read as a fallback until v4.4, but a deprecation warning will appear in the export worker logs. Behavior is unchanged: `utc` forces all timestamps to UTC, `viewer` uses the requesting user's timezone. On-call: if exports fail after the rollout, confirm the new key is present in the worker env file, directly above the signing credential line.

vault entry, yahif-yajep: COURIER_KEY29=b802bdf8034096b65a51c6ba5abe2

Subject: Canteen access

Hi all,

Quick note from the front desk: our canteen on Level 1 is shared with Bramleigh Analytics next door. Their staff enter from the west side; ours from the east. Keep the connecting door shut outside lunch hours. To get through the east canteen door, use the code shown below.

door code, kawip-bagap: bdg-HQEWH-4